Market Development History

During the mid-20th century, the Belgian metal tool industry relied heavily on manually machined bolts. The introduction of standardized DIN norms in the 1960s and 70s allowed for the mass adoption of the socket head design, replacing traditional hexagonal heads in compact tool assemblies.

By the 1990s, the transition to high-tensile alloy steels became the norm. The industry saw a shift toward cold-heading technology, which significantly improved the fatigue strength of the allen head bolt caps used in heavy-duty cutting machinery across the Port of Antwerp and industrial hubs.

How to choose the right grade for bulk socket head cap screws in CNC tools?

For CNC applications in Belgium, we recommend Grade 12.9 alloy steel for maximum tensile strength and fatigue resistance, ensuring the assembly remains secure under high-speed rotation.

Do your allen bolt socket head products comply with European DIN standards?

Yes, all our products are manufactured strictly according to DIN 912 and ISO 4762 standards, ensuring perfect compatibility with European tools and machinery.

What is the best corrosion protection for an allen cap bolt used in coastal Belgium?

For the humid maritime climate of the Belgian coast, we suggest Zinc-Nickel plating or stainless steel A4 (316) to prevent oxidation and maintain thread integrity.
